Underweight
Below 18.5
Normal
18.5 – 24.9
Overweight
25.0 – 29.9
Obese
30.0 and above
What is BMI?
Body Mass Index (BMI) is a simple calculation using a person's height and weight. The formula is BMI = kg/m², where kg is a person's weight in kilograms and m² is their height in metres squared.
While BMI doesn't measure body fat directly, it correlates moderately with more direct measures of body fat. It's a useful screening tool to identify potential weight problems in adults.
Important Limitations
BMI is a general screening tool and does not account for muscle mass, bone density, age, sex, or ethnicity. It should not be used as the sole indicator of health. Always consult a healthcare professional for a comprehensive assessment.
